Trade 1st and 3rd (via Giants) to TB for their 1st and 2nd. 

1 (via TB)- Henry Ruggs III, WR, Alabama... I like Ruggs more then I do Lamb or Jeudy. Ruggs is not the proficient route runner of Juedy or the lanky red zone threat of Lamb but Ruggs has the speed, strength and hands to make his living on the outside. 

2. (Via TB) Lucas Niang, OT, TCU- he's in that 2nd tier OT category and prob the last one left at this point.  I'd imagine Cleveland, Jones, Jackson and Wilson are all off the board here. But Niang is also in that 2nd tier list for me. (4 top tier and about 7 in that 2nd tier). 

2. Laviska Shenault, WR, Col- this is such a wild card pick. Theres sooo many amazing wideouts that SOMEONE has to fall. I think the top 10 wr's in this draft would all be top 15 picks in most other drafts. That's how much talent this wr class has... and why i want to double dip here. Shenault was the top WR coming into 2020 and a BEAST with the ball in his hands. Him and Ruggs would be amazing compliments. 

3. Noah Igbinoghene, CB, Auburn- I did say this is what I wanted to happen. I doubt he falls but I've seen some rankings have him as low as the 12th best cb some as high as #5. Either way, I like his playstyle and I see quick feet and a knack for jumping routes. 

4. Logan Stenberg, OG, Kentucky

5. Alton Robinson, Edge, Syracuse 

6. Lamichael Perine, RB Fla

6. James Morgan, QB, FIU
